Description

Embu Governor Martin Wambora (left), together with Deputy Governor Dorothy Nditi (right) and an unidentified worshipper, follows the proceedings of an interdenominational county prayer service at ACK St. Paul’s Cathedral, Embu Town, on May 18, 2014. Religious leaders criticized the impeachment process. Wambora said he would not resign.
